Overview of the Three English Tests

  1. IELTS (International English Language Testing System)
  • What it is: IELTS is a globally recognized English proficiency test jointly managed by the British Council, IDP, and Cambridge Assessment English. It assesses listening, reading, writing, and speaking skills.
  • Types: Academic (for university admission) and General Training (for immigration and work).
  • Country Preferences: Widely accepted in the UK, Australia, Canada, New Zealand, and many European countries. The USA also accepts IELTS scores at many universities.
  • Test Format: Paper-based and computer-delivered options available.
  • Test Duration: Around 2 hours 45 minutes.
  1. T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language)
  • What it is: TOEFL is administered by ETS (Educational Testing Service) and primarily tests academic English through reading, listening, speaking, and writing modules.
  • Types: The most common is TOEFL iBT (Internet-Based Test).
  • Country Preferences: Widely accepted in the USA, Canada, Australia, and many European countries. Some universities in the UK also accept the TOEFL.
  • Test Format: Online (internet-based) test only.
  • Test Duration: Around 3 hours.
  1. Duolingo English Test
  • What it is: A newer, fully online English proficiency test that evaluates reading, writing, speaking, and listening skills. It uses AI technology to assess language ability.
  • Country Preferences: Increasingly accepted by universities in the USA, Canada, and some other countries, especially during the COVID-19 pandemic for its remote test-taking convenience.
  • Test Format: Fully online, taken from home with a laptop/desktop.
  • Test Duration: Approximately 1 hour.
FeatureIELTSTOEFLDuolingo English Test
Test OwnershipBritish Council, IDP, Cambridge EnglishETS (Educational Testing Service)Duolingo Inc.
Test FormatPaper-based & computer-deliveredOnline internet-based onlyFully online, at-home
Test Duration~2 hours 45 minutes~3 hours~1 hour
Test SectionsListening, Reading, Writing, SpeakingListening, Reading, Speaking, WritingReading, Writing, Speaking, Listening
Speaking Test TypeFace-to-face with examinerRecorded responsesRecorded responses via computer
Scoring ScaleBand score 0-9Score 0-120Score 10-160
Result Waiting Time5-7 days (computer), 13 days (paper)Approx. 6 daysWithin 48 hours
Test Fee in Bangladesh~24,000 BDT (May 2025)~24,000 BDT (May 2025)~10,000-12,000 BDT (May 2025)
Test Centers AvailabilityMultiple centers in Dhaka, Chattogram, Sylhet, RajshahiLimited centers mostly Dhaka & ChattogramNo test center; taken online from home
Accepted by UniversitiesUK, Australia, Canada, New Zealand, USA, EuropeUSA, Canada, Australia, Europe, UKGrowing acceptance in USA, Canada, few others
Visa AcceptanceWidely accepted for immigration (UK, Australia, Canada)Accepted by many countries for student visasLimited acceptance for visas
Test Registration ProcessOnline or via centersOnline onlyOnline only
Test FlexibilityScheduled fixed datesScheduled fixed datesFlexible test scheduling any time
Test AccessibilityRequires going to test centerRequires going to test centerCan be done remotely from home
Preparation ResourcesWidely available (books, courses, online)Widely available (books, courses, online)Online practice tests and videos

Which Countries Prefer Which Tests? 🌍

CountryPreferred Test(s)Notes
USATOEFL (most popular), IELTS, DuolingoTOEFL is widely accepted, but many US universities now accept IELTS and Duolingo.
UKIELTS (most popular), TOEFLIELTS is generally preferred for UK visa and admissions.
CanadaIELTS, TOEFL, DuolingoIELTS is very common, TOEFL accepted, Duolingo gaining acceptance.
AustraliaIELTS (preferred), TOEFLIELTS is generally preferred by universities and visa authorities.
New ZealandIELTS (preferred), TOEFLIELTS preferred for study and immigration.
EuropeIELTS, TOEFLDepends on the country/university; many accept both IELTS and TOEFL.

Test Center Availability in Bangladesh & Chattogram 📍

  • IELTS has multiple test centers across Bangladesh, including the British Council and IDP offices in Dhaka and Chattogram. This makes it accessible for many students.
  • TOEFL iBT is offered at selected test centers mainly in Dhaka and Chattogram. Availability might be limited compared to IELTS.
  • Duolingo English Test is an at-home online test, so students anywhere in Bangladesh, including remote areas, can take it without traveling.

Which Test Should You Choose? 🤔

  • Choose IELTS if: You are applying to UK, Australia, New Zealand, or Canadian universities, or prefer a face-to-face speaking test. Also a good option for immigration purposes to these countries.
  • Choose TOEFL if: You are aiming mostly for universities in the USA or Canada, prefer an online format, and want a test widely accepted by American universities.
  • Choose Duolingo if: You need a quick, affordable, and fully online test option, especially if traveling to a test center is difficult. However, check university acceptance before registering.
